AMESBURY WILTSHIRE = BYWAY 20 - VEHICLE ONLY TRO

http://www.wiltshire.gov.uk/council/consultations/troconsultations/troconsultaionbyway20amesbury.htm

Closing date for objection is 20th June 2016. Online objections can be made at the above link.

Seems WCC has let a housing estate be built next to the byway (which has now become an inconveneince), after a long sucession of "temporary" TROs on this lane.

The order is to "preserve the character" of this byway, which has a solid concrete surface for most of its length! Previously it was an access road between green fields, so ironically, its the housing estate thats the real cultpit in destroying the character of the lane!
